How do you perform disk diffusion method?
The method consists of placing paper disks saturated with antimicrobial agents on a lawn of bacteria seeded on the surface of an agar medium, incubating the plate overnight, and measuring the presence or absence of a zone of inhibition around the disks (Figure 1).
What media is used for the Kirby-Bauer method?
The standard medium for the Kirby-Bauer method of susceptibility testing is Mueller-Hinton agar (MHA) [6]. Because of the number of difficulties and financial issues, MHA is not a feasible option in many developing countries, and instead, NA is used for AST [7].

Article first time published onWhat does a low MIC mean?
Minimum inhibitory concentration (MIC) can be determined by culturing microorganisms in liquid media or on plates of solid growth medium. A lower MIC value indicates that less drug is required for inhibiting growth of the organism; therefore, drugs with lower MIC scores are more effective antimicrobial agents.
How do you make Mueller Hinton agar?
- Suspend 38g of your Mueller Hinton agar powder (CM0337B) in 1L of distilled water.
- Mix and dissolve them completely.
- Sterilize by autoclaving at 121°C for 15 minutes.
- Pour the liquid into the petri dish and wait for the medium to solidify.
How does an E test work?
ETEST is a well-established method for Minimum Inhibitory Concentration (MIC) determinations in microbiology laboratories around the world. ETEST consists of a predefined gradient of antibiotic concentrations immobilized on a plastic strip and is used to determine the MIC of antibiotics and antifungal agents.

What factors must be carefully controlled in Kirby Bauer method?
- Size of inoculum.
- Distribution of the inoculum.
- Incubation period.
- Growth rate of bacterium.
- Depth of agar.
- Diffusion rate of the antibiotic.
- Concentration of antibiotic in the disk.

How do you analyze zone of inhibition?
Take a ruler or caliper that measures in millimeters and place the “0” in the center of the antibiotic disk. Measure from the center of the disk to the edge of area with zero growth. Take your measurement in millimeters. This measures the radius of the zone of inhibition.
What are the different sensitivity testing methods?
In-vitro antimicrobial susceptibility testing can be performed using a variety of formats, the most common being disk diffusion, agar dilution, broth macrodilution, broth microdilution, and a concentration gradient test.

What are factors that affect the results of the antimicrobial sensitivity test?
The main factors thought to affect reproducibility of susceptibility testing include inoculum, media composition and depth, delay between application of the disc and incubation, temperature, atmosphere and duration of incubation, generation time, the antibiotic concentration of the disc and the method of reading zone …
What is MIC90?
MIC90 = Minimum Inhibitory Concentration required to inhibit the growth of 90% of organisms.

How do you make MH broth?
Dissolve 21 g in 1 litre of distilled water. Sterilize by autoclaving at 121°C for 15 minutes. Principle and Interpretation: Mueller Hinton Broth is used for determining minimal inhibitory concentrations (MICs).
